About This Item
Boston: Houghton Mifflin. Near Fine in Very Good- dust jacket. 1929. First Edition; First Printing. Hardcover. SIGNED and inscribed by author Simpson on free front endpaper to noted Western author Henry Herbert (H. H. ) Knibbs, near fine in very good minus dust jacket; small chips to jacket at spine ends, tiny cracks to jacket edges else a tight square unmarked copy in unclipped dust jacket; first printing with no later statements; a well-preserved copy; inscription reads: 'Henry Herbert Knibbs- who knows his Alice-Corbin-land - from Wm. H. Simpson / Chicago, May 8th, 1929 / You fly with the winds, years! '; photos on request ; 89 pages; Signed by Author .
